Don't recommend deprecated debugger script (#26171)

yarn debug-test is now deprecated in React package.json. It has been
replaced by yarn test --debug.

3. If you've fixed a bug or added code that should be tested, add tests!
4. Ensure the test suite passes (`yarn test`). Tip: `yarn test --watch TestName` is helpful in development.
5. Run `yarn test --prod` to test in the production environment. It supports the same options as `yarn test`.
6. If you need a debugger, run `yarn debug-test --watch TestName`, open `chrome://inspect`, and press "Inspect".
6. If you need a debugger, run `yarn test --debug --watch TestName`, open `chrome://inspect`, and press "Inspect".
7. Format your code with [prettier](https://github.com/prettier/prettier) (`yarn prettier`).
8. Make sure your code lints (`yarn lint`). Tip: `yarn linc` to only check changed files.
9. Run the [Flow](https://flowtype.org/) type checks (`yarn flow`).
